The SSA-Challenge Programme• Major FARA experiment with an IS approach: 36

Innovation Platforms (IP) in a controlled experimental design ($ 26 million)

• Statistical analysis (Pamuk, Bulte & Adekunle, in prep.): IPs ‘work’, and better than conventional extension and controls: more poverty alleviation, more and more diverse innovative activity

• Statistical analysis (Van Rijn & Bulte, in prep.): mechanism by which IPs work is linkage with external actors; becoming part of network of such actors

• Similar findings from CoS 5 years after: technologies that involve factors over which farmers have no control do not persist (Sterk et al., in prep.)

CoS-SIS: Convergence of Sciences: Strengthening Innovation Systems

• 9 Innovation Platforms, € 4.5 million• Focus on understanding mechanisms• 30 years of promoting science-based technologies to

increase yields per ha have left us with few successes (e.g., Gabre-Mahdin & Haggblade 2004)

• Institutions explain a major proportion of the variance in the quality and quantity of smallholder production (cocoa Ghana, cotton Benin, rice Mali)

• Not absence of institutions: complex institutional context often ‘unhelpful’ for smallholders

Performance Indicators

• Ability to ‘think institutions’, in addition to cost-benefit; technological transfer; participation; etc.

• Not dismiss institutions as ‘politics’ about which one can do little

• Ability to scope and diagnose: translate smallholder constraints into attributes of institutional context

• Analyse actor networks to identify key actors and champions who can take concerted action.

• With those actors: design institutional experiments and measure impact

Experience industrial agricultures• Institutional development preceded

technology-enhanced growth in productivity;• Agricultural leaders developed vision of an

enabling context for family farming: synergy of farmer education, extension, research, credit, crop insurance, subsidies, land tenure, equitable market access, etc.

• Not a uniform package but adaptive, context- and domain-specific
